Nokia N95 8GB A sensational device!

I have the Nokia N95 8GB for almost two months now. When I purchased this phone, I did not know that it consists of so many world class features. There are many latest Nokia phones in the market which include the Nokia N85, Nokia N79 and Nokia 5800 XpressMusic. But I am very much pleased with the features of my handset. Its dual opening mechanism feature is unique that allows me to operate this handset easily. Its 5 mega pixel camera provides me the option to add certain effects to the pictures like sephia, black and negative and its allows me to take good quality pictures both in landscape and portrait mode. I often use its secondary camera for clicking self images but other than that it can also be used to take part in a 3G video call.
Nokia N95 8GB
The size of its display is quite large that supports 16 million colours. The other useful features of the phone is push to talk, document viewer and GPS navigation. You can also send Emails through your Nokia N95 8GB and pictures and text messages to suitable devices. An integrated music player and FM radio are also present in this handset. Like all the latest Nokia phones, this handset is also equipped with latest technologies like 3G, HSCSD, EDGE and WLAN Wi-Fi which help me surf the web at high speed without any hassle. Features like Bluetooth and USB permit me to share data with other compatible devices through a wired connection or wirelessly.

The handset runs on Symbian operating system and supports Quad Band technology that gives the option to enjoy world wide network coverage. Its storage capacity is enough for storing loads of music files, wallpaper, photographs and other useful data. The handset comes with 160 MB of internal memory and supports microSD card up to 8GB.
